Sep 7, 2019 · The $280 million lawsuit against AMC alleges that Frank Darabont never received payment for developing The Walking Dead and was wrongfully dismissed without warning in order to avoid a contractual pay rise that would've kicked in for seasons 2 and 3.   3. Frank Darabont (born Ferenc Árpád Darabont, January 28, 1959) is a French-born American director of Hungarian descent, who is most well-known for his award-winning film adaptations of Stephen King's works, as well as being the creator and the first season showrunner of AMC's The Walking Dead.

  7. Frank Darabont. Writer: The Shawshank Redemption. Three-time Oscar nominee Frank Darabont was born in a refugee camp in 1959 in Montbeliard, France, the son of Hungarian parents who had fled Budapest during the failed 1956 Hungarian revolution.
